This ground beef lo mein recipe is a delicious, budget-friendly, stir-fry dinner with ground beef and vegetables cooked in an Asian-flavored sauce.
Preparation Time
20 mins
Cooking Time
20 mins
Total Time
40 mins
Calories
517 Calories
Recipe Instructions
Step 1
Meanwhile, cook ground beef in a large skillet over medium heat until browned and crumbly, but still a little chunky, about 5 minutes. Remove from skillet and set aside.
Step 2
Whisk hoisin sauce, soy sauce, oyster sauce, water, sherry, sesame oil, cornstarch, and brown sugar together in a small bowl.
Step 3
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Cook spaghetti in boiling water, stirring occasionally, until tender yet firm to the bite, about 12 minutes.
Step 4
Heat olive oil in the same skillet over medium-high heat. Add red bell pepper, onion, snow peas, celery, ginger, garlic, and red pepper flakes. Stir-fry until vegetables are tender, about 5 minutes. Return ground beef to the skillet and mix well.
Step 5
Drain spaghetti and add to the skillet with sauce. Cook and stir until mixture is well combined and sauce has slightly thickened, about 3 minutes. Serve immediately and garnish with sliced green onions.
